Top 5 Hypercasual Games in Belarus Q2 2022

Throughout the second quarter of 2022, the performance of the top 5 hypercasual games in Belarus showcased varied tr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a closer look at how each game fared:

Tall Man Run from Supersonic Studios LTD saw a significant increase in weekly downloads, peaking at around 33.4K in early May. However, downloads gradually declined to approximately 5.3K by the end of June. Active users followed a similar trend, starting at 2.1K in late March, surging to 77.1K in mid-May, and then dropping to around 22K by the end of the quarter. Revenue was minimal, with only a brief spike to $4 in early June.

Wall Kickers by Kumobius experienced a steady increase in weekly downloads, hitting a peak of 21.4K in mid-May before stabilizing at around 15.9K towards the end of June. Weekly revenue showed modest gains, reaching up to $33 in the last week of June. Active users climbed consistently, starting from 15.3K in late March and reaching a high of 93.3K by the end of the quarter.

Going Balls, another title from Supersonic Studios LTD, had relatively stable weekly downloads, varying between 4.4K and 12.7K throughout the quarter. Revenue peaked at $25 in mid-June, though overall earnings were low. Active users showed a gradual decline from 34.2K in late March to around 24.4K by the end of June.

Solar Smash from Paradyme Games witnessed a sharp decline in weekly downloads, from 25.4K in early April to about 2.9K by the end of June. Active users also decreased significantly from 86.4K in early April to approximately 21K by the end of June. Revenue remained negligible throughout the quarter.

White Rasha by O2 Publishing had a fluctuating download pattern, starting at 37.3K in early April and dropping to around 1.6K by the end of June. Active users also saw a decline from 57.9K in early April to about 30.9K in late June. Revenue data was not available for this game.
